Power Off: Turn off the pool pump and disconnect the power supply to the pump and any associated gear before starting any maintenance. Inspect the O-Rings: Check the O-rings on the pump lid, strainer housing, and any other accessible areas. Remove the basket from the pump and examine the basket for accumulated debris or leaves. Lubricate the O-rings with a silicone-based lubricant to make sure a correct seal. Search for signs of wear, cracks, or damage. Remove any debris, leaves, or other objects which will have accumulated in the pump basket and strainer housing. Clean the Pump Basket: Open the pump basket lid and use the given tool to open it. Clean them thoroughly to make sure correct water circulate. Verify Proper Water Flow: Check the inlet and outlet pipes, as well because the impeller, for any obstructions. Remove the debris and leaves and rinse the basket with water earlier than placing it back into the pump.
Remove any debris or clogs that may hinder the water circulation through the pump. Check with the producer’s tips to determine if lubrication is critical and use the appropriate lubricant if required. In the event you notice something unusual, seek the advice of a pool technician for additional inspection. Inspect Motor and Electrical Components: Examine the motor and electrical parts of the pump for any signs of harm or wear. The electrolytic cell homes the system’s titanium blades, which have a catalytic coating of Ruthenium Oxide (RuO2). The 2 acceptable strategies for movement detection are mechanical circulation switches or electronic fuel traps. A gas trap makes use of the water’s conductivity to shut the circuit between two points throughout the cell. According to UL Standards 1081, Swimming Pool Pumps, Filters, and Chlorinators, a circulate detection gadget have to be designed into the ECG. The lifespan for a typical residential cell is approximately 10,000 hours of chlorine generation, while a industrial cell will final for approximately 15,000 hours. When there may be inadequate stream, gas generates inside the cell physique and opens the circuit between the 2 points, shutting off energy to the cell. Over time, this coating is sacrificed to generate chlorine, which means it is going to should be changed when it wears out. A flow swap places a flat paddle in the stream of water and pushes it to activate a micro change when there’s sufficient circulation.
The most important component, salt, or sodium chloride (NaCl), is added for 2 causes. Keep in thoughts, some techniques provide a salt-level estimate, based on the amps and volts to the cell, which are influenced by water temperatures and remaining cell life (decrease salt level displayed). First, it increases conductivity in the water to create the electrolytic reaction, and secondly, it is the supply from which chlorine is generated. At this level, breakpoint chlorination can also be reached, which eliminates the damaging effects of chloramines (NH2Cl) brought on by chlorine reacting to bather waste (e.g. physique oils, cosmetics, suntan lotions, perspiration, urine, and so on.). Salt ranges needs to be examined quarterly and/or after heavy rain fall. In cold temperature situations, or with an older cell, salt levels must be verified first by testing the water previous to including more salt. For winterized swimming pools, ranges needs to be examined in the beginning of the season and no less than once through the season. If salt check levels are inconsistent with the salt display on the control unit, it needs to be calibrated to match the test results (if potential). The result is better water high quality, and in the case of indoor pools, air quality as well. Further, this process generates chlorine at a high concentration throughout the cell, providing efficient and effective remedy of water passing through the cell. The electrolytic course of generates hypochlorous acid (HClO) to create sustainable chlorine residuals by recombining sodium to chloride. During this ongoing course of, salt doesn’t diminish; it is reusable, making this an environment friendly methodology of water sanitation. Since salt is not lost by evaporation, it mustn’t fluctuate an excessive amount of.
